WebJan 28, 2024 · The phrase to grasp the nettle means to tackle a difficulty boldly. It stems from the idea that it takes some pluck to put to the test the belief that a nettle stings less painfully when seized tightly than when touched lightly. The English author John Lyly (circa 1553-1606) seems to have implicitly referred to that idea in Euphues. WebSep 2, 2024 · Use cool compresses. WebApr 22, 2024 · A hearty nettle soup. For a basic soup you'll need about 200g of fresh nettle tips. Add 450g of potatoes, peeled and cubed, a dash of cream and one litre of stock. Boil the potatoes until soft and steam the nettles. Drain the spuds and add the nettles and stock. Bring the boil, whisk with a hand blender, add a dash of cream and season.
